Dale Steyn Discontinues His Bowling Coach Role With Sunrises Hyderabad Before IPL 2025  

South African fast bowling sensation and legend Dale Steyn will leave his position as bowling coach of Sunrisers Hyderabad in the IPL 2025. He will, however, continue to work for the Sunrisers Eastern Cape franchise in the SA20. Steyn was hired before the 2022 season, withdrew from the IPL 2024 due to personal reasons, and was replaced by former New Zealand fast bowler James Franklin. 

In 2021, Steyn was appointed as SRH’s bowling coach under head coach Tom Moody. After Moody left in 2023, Brian Lara took over him, and Daniel Vettori was named the new head coach before the 2024 campaign. SRH advanced to their first final since 2018 under Vettori; however, they were defeated by the Kolkata Knight Riders (KKR). But with Eastern Cape, Steyn won two consecutive SA T20 titles in 2023 and 2024. 

On Wednesday, Steyen announced his intentions to leave his bowling coach position in SRH in a post on X (formerly Twitter) in which he said, “A big thank you to Sunrisers Hyderabad for my few years with them as bowling coach at the IPL; unfortunately, I won’t be returning for IPL 2025,” Steyn said on X (formerly Twitter). “However, I will continue to work with Sunrisers Eastern Cape in the SA20 here in South Africa. Two-time winners here in SA20; let’s try to make it three in a row.”
